The borosilicate glassware or simply soda-lime-silica glass is the type of glass employed in pharmaceutical glass. Borosilicate glass is ideal for packaging water for injection and parenteral along with non-parenteral drugs because of its durability and capacity to contain potent acids and alkalis. For aqueous products, it serves as the pharmaceutical glass material of choice.
Depending on their size, glass bottles utilized in pharmaceutical packaging can be divided into two categories: small bottles and big bottles. Reagents, in addition to transfusion and infusion bottles, are packaged in large-size glass bottles. Syrup and various other oral liquids are packaged in the little glass bottles. The market for small-sized bottles is anticipated to expand as a result of a number of new possibilities, including the increased popularity of oral medications that come in small bottles. - Glass Vials: Glass vials dominate the pharmaceutical glass packaging industry and typically account for 40–60% of the total market share, making them the most widely used container type. Vials are extensively used for packaging vaccines, biologics, and injectable drugs due to their superior chemical stability, sterility, and compatibility with sensitive formulations. In 2023 alone, global shipments of glass vials reached approximately 10.9 billion units, demonstrating their essential role in pharmaceutical supply chains. Vials are commonly manufactured using Type I borosilicate glass, which provides excellent resistance to thermal shock and chemical interaction with drug formulations. The COVID-19 vaccination campaigns significantly increased demand for vials worldwide, highlighting their importance in mass immunization programs. Moreover, pharmaceutical manufacturers prefer vials for multi-dose and single-dose injectable medicines because they maintain high sterility standards and long shelf life. With the continued expansion of biologic drugs and injectable therapies, glass vials are expected to remain the dominant packaging format in the pharmaceutical industry.
- Ampoules: Ampoules represent approximately 15–18% of the pharmaceutical glass packaging market, primarily used for single-dose injectable medications. Ampoules are small sealed glass containers designed to provide hermetic sealing, which ensures complete protection from contamination and oxidation. This makes them particularly suitable for packaging sensitive drugs such as anesthetics, emergency medicines, and high-potency injectable solutions. Global production of pharmaceutical ampoules reached around 2.7 billion units in 2023, with 2 mL and 5 mL formats accounting for more than 70% of shipments. Ampoules are widely used in hospital settings because they guarantee sterility until the moment of use. Their flame-sealed design prevents microbial contamination, making them ideal for critical medical applications. However, the segment has experienced moderate competition from vials and prefilled syringes in recent years. Despite this, ampoules remain important in many pharmaceutical markets, especially for emergency medicine and small-volume injectable drugs.

DRIVING FACTORS
Improvement in the Stability of the Medicine to Aid Market Expansion
Atmospheric gases including oxygen and carbon dioxide are hindered by the glass and are unable to reach the main container. To lessen the risk of drug pollution, this is crucial. Drugs are less susceptible to oxidant and hydrolytic degradation when stored in glass containers. Additionally, glass containers assist prevent volatile substances from escaping, improving the stability of the medicine. During the projected period, all of these variables are expected to drive up product demand.
